TYPE 2 COMMANDS (balance input functions)
COMMAND RESPONSE PURPOSE
[register number]_STORE[CR]
None
Stores the current weight, at the greatest
possible resolution, in the specified
register.
[Decimal
number]_ENTER_[register
number]_STORE[CR]
None
Stores the number entered, in the
current units, as an additive constant in
the register specified.
[decimal
number]_ENTER_CONVERT_[register
number]_STORE[CR]
None
Stores the number entered, as a "last
front panel units" relative multiplier, in
the specified register.
[decimal number]_TARE[CR]
None
Adds the number entered, in current
units, to the TARE register. CLEAR
[CR] zeroes the TARE register.
TYPE 3 COMMANDS (balance output functions)
COMMAND RESPONSE PURPOSE
SEND[CR]
See the RS-232 Balance Message
Formats section..
Returns the contents of the display
register.
[register number]_RCL[CR]
REG XXX:[register contents][current
units or 'MULT.'] [CR] [LF]
Sends the contents of the specified
register in the current units if it is
additive or with the designator 'MULT.'
if it is multiplicative. An unflagged
number is sent with no designator. An
undefined register returns a ? with a
[CR][LF].
RCL_TARE[CR]
REG 091:[TARE register contents]
[current units][CR][LR]
Return the TARE register's contents.
RCL_[(CONVERT)(CAL)]
REG XXX:[contents of specified
register][MULT.][CR][LF]
Returns indicated register contents, if in
that mode. If not in that mode then a ?
with a [CR][LF] is returned.
RCL_PCS[CR] REG
XXX:[contents of pieces
register][last FP units/pc][CR][LF]
Returns pieces register contents
expressed as last front panel units/pc, if
in that mode. If not in that mode then a
? with a [CR][LF] is returned.
[register number]_RCL_TARE[CR]
REG XXX:[register contents][current
units][CR][LF]
Adds the specified register contents to
the TARE register.
RCL_XAVG[CR]
[average weight] [current units]
AVX[CR][LF]. [2 second delay].
[number of samples taken]
###[CR][LF]. [2 second delay].
[standard deviation] [ current units]
SDEV[CR][LF]. [2 second delay].
[relative standard deviation]
COV[CR][LF].
Sends the results of a standard deviation
run. The TBAR mode, if in use, is
temporarily suspended while this
process is going on.
